Skip to content

Commit

Permalink
Merge pull request #69 from LinuxSuRen/core-hudson
Browse files Browse the repository at this point in the history
Add i18n for hudson message
  • Loading branch information
Zhao Xiaojie authored May 2, 2019
2 parents a24aaff + f6bf820 commit ac86546
Show file tree
Hide file tree
Showing 2 changed files with 54 additions and 1 deletion.
53 changes: 53 additions & 0 deletions core/src/main/resources/hudson/Messages_zh_CN.properties
Original file line number Diff line number Diff line change
Expand Up @@ -42,3 +42,56 @@ Util.pastTime={0}
PluginManager.DisplayName=\u63D2\u4EF6\u7BA1\u7406
AboutJenkins.DisplayName=\u5173\u4E8EJenkins
AboutJenkins.Description=\u67E5\u770B\u7248\u672C\u4EE5\u53CA\u8BC1\u4E66\u4FE1\u606F\u3002

FilePath.did_not_manage_to_validate_may_be_too_sl=\u65E0\u6CD5\u7BA1\u7406\u9A8C\u8BC1{0}\uFF08\u53EF\u80FD\u7531\u4E8E\u592A\u6162\u4E86\uFF09
FilePath.validateAntFileMask.whitespaceSeparator=\
\u4E0D\u80FD\u4F7F\u7528\u7A7A\u683C\u4F5C\u4E3A\u5206\u9694\u7B26\uFF0C\u8BF7\u4F7F\u7528\u2018,\u2019\u4F5C\u4E3A\u5206\u9694\u7B26\u3002
FilePath.validateAntFileMask.doesntMatchAndSuggest=\
\u2018{0}\u2019\u6CA1\u6709\u5339\u914D\u5230\u4EFB\u4F55\u5185\u5BB9\uFF0C\u4F46\u662F\u2018{1}\u2019\u6709\u5339\u914D\u3002\u4F60\u671F\u671B\u7684\u53EF\u80FD\u662F\u540E\u8005\uFF1F
FilePath.validateAntFileMask.portionMatchAndSuggest=\u5C3D\u7BA1\u2018{1}\u2019\u5B58\u5728\uFF0C\u4F46\u2018{0}\u2019\u6CA1\u6709\u5339\u914D\u5230\u4EFB\u4F55\u5185\u5BB9
FilePath.validateAntFileMask.portionMatchButPreviousNotMatchAndSuggest=\u2018{0}\u2019\u6CA1\u6709\u5339\u914D\u5230\u4EFB\u4F55\u5185\u5BB9\uFF1A\u2018{1}\u2019\u5B58\u5728\uFF0C\u4F46\u4E0D\u662F\u2018{2}\u2019
FilePath.validateAntFileMask.doesntMatchAnything=\u2018{0}\u2019\u6CA1\u6709\u5339\u914D\u5230\u4EFB\u4F55\u5185\u5BB9
FilePath.validateAntFileMask.matchWithCaseInsensitive=\u7531\u4E8E\u662F\u5927\u5C0F\u5199\u654F\u611F\u7684\uFF0C\u2018{0}\u2019\u6CA1\u6709\u5339\u914D\u5230\u4EFB\u4F55\u5185\u5BB9\u3002\u4F60\u5FFD\u7565\u5927\u5C0F\u5199\u540E\u4E5F\u8BB8\u80FD\u5339\u914D\u5230
FilePath.validateAntFileMask.doesntMatchAnythingAndSuggest=\u2018{0}\u2019\u6CA1\u6709\u5339\u914D\u5230\u4EFB\u4F55\u5185\u5BB9\uFF1A\u751A\u81F3\u2018{1}\u2019\u4E5F\u4E0D\u5B58\u5728

PluginManager.PluginDoesntSupportDynamicLoad.RestartRequired=\u63D2\u4EF6{0}\u4E0D\u652F\u6301\u52A8\u6001\u52A0\u8F7D\u3002Jenkins \u91CD\u542F\u540E\u624D\u80FD\u751F\u6548\u3002
PluginManager.PluginIsAlreadyInstalled.RestartRequired=\u63D2\u4EF6{0}\u5DF2\u7ECF\u5B89\u88C5\u5B8C\u6210\u3002Jenkins \u91CD\u542F\u540E\u624D\u80FD\u751F\u6548\u3002

FilePath.TildaDoesntWork=\u53EA\u6709 Unix shell \u4E2D\u652F\u6301 \u2018~\u2019 \u8FD9\u4E2A\u7B26\u53F7\uFF0C\u5176\u4ED6\u7684\u5730\u65B9\u4E0D\u652F\u6301\u3002

PluginManager.PortNotANumber=\u7AEF\u53E3\u4E0D\u662F\u6570\u5B57
PluginManager.PortNotInRange=\u7AEF\u53E3\u8D85\u51FA\u4E86\u4ECE{0}\u5230{1}\u7684\u8303\u56F4
PluginManager.UploadPluginsPermission.Description=\
"\u4E0A\u4F20\u63D2\u4EF6"\u7684\u6743\u9650\u5141\u8BB8\u7528\u6237\u4E0A\u4F20\u4EFB\u610F\u7684\u63D2\u4EF6\u3002
PluginManager.ConfigureUpdateCenterPermission.Description=\
"\u914D\u7F6E\u66F4\u65B0\u4E2D\u5FC3"\u7684\u6743\u9650\u5141\u8BB8\u7528\u6237\u914D\u7F6E\u66F4\u65B0\u4E2D\u5FC3\u4EE5\u53CA\u4EE3\u7406\u8BBE\u7F6E\u3002
PluginManager.PluginCycleDependenciesMonitor.DisplayName=\u5FAA\u73AF\u4F9D\u8D56\u68C0\u6D4B\u5668
PluginManager.PluginUpdateMonitor.DisplayName=\u65E0\u6548\u7684\u63D2\u4EF6\u914D\u7F6E
PluginManager.CheckUpdateServerError=\u68C0\u67E5\u66F4\u65B0\u4E2D\u5FC3: {0} \u65F6\u53D1\u751F\u9519\u8BEF
PluginManager.UpdateSiteError=\u5C1D\u8BD5\u68C0\u67E5\u66F4\u65B0\u4E2D\u5FC3{0}\u6B21\u540E\u5931\u8D25\u3002\u6700\u540E\u7684\u5F02\u5E38\u662F\uFF1A{1}
PluginManager.UpdateSiteChangeLogLevel=\u4FEE\u6539{0}\u7684\u65E5\u5FD7\u7EA7\u522B\u4E3A WARNING \u6216\u8005\u66F4\u4F4E\uFF0C\u67E5\u770B\u66F4\u8BE6\u7EC6\u7684\u4FE1\u606F\uFF0C\u4EE5\u53CA\u6BCF\u6B21\u5C1D\u8BD5\u7684\u9519\u8BEF\u4FE1\u606F
PluginManager.UnexpectedException=\u91CD\u8BD5\u68C0\u67E5\u66F4\u65B0\u670D\u52A1\u5668\u8FC7\u7A0B\u4E2D\u9047\u5230\u4E86\u672A\u77E5\u7684\u5F02\u5E38

ProxyConfiguration.TestUrlRequired=\u9700\u8981\u6D4B\u8BD5\u7528\u7684 URL \u5730\u5740\u3002
ProxyConfiguration.MalformedTestUrl=\u6D4B\u8BD5\u7684 URL {0} \u683C\u5F0F\u9519\u8BEF\u3002
ProxyConfiguration.FailedToConnectViaProxy=\u8FDE\u63A5{0}\u5931\u8D25\u3002
ProxyConfiguration.FailedToConnect=\u8FDE\u63A5{0}\u5931\u8D25(\u4EE3\u7801 {1})\u3002
ProxyConfiguration.Success=\u6210\u529F

Functions.NoExceptionDetails=\u6CA1\u6709\u5F02\u5E38\u7684\u8BE6\u7EC6\u4FE1\u606F

PluginWrapper.missing={0}\u7684\u7248\u672C{1}\u4E22\u5931\u3002\u5B89\u88C5\u7248\u672C{1}\u6216\u8005\u66F4\u9AD8\u7684\u53EF\u4EE5\u4FEE\u590D\u3002
PluginWrapper.failed_to_load_plugin={0}\u7684\u7248\u672C{1}\u52A0\u8F7D\u5931\u8D25\u3002
PluginWrapper.failed_to_load_dependency={0}\u7684\u7248\u672C{1}\u52A0\u8F7D\u5931\u8D25\u3002\u9996\u5148\u9700\u8981\u4FEE\u590D\u8BE5\u63D2\u4EF6\u3002
PluginWrapper.disabledAndObsolete={0}\u7684\u7248\u672C{1}\u88AB\u7981\u7528\uFF0C\u9700\u8981\u66F4\u9AD8\u7684\u7248\u672C\u3002\u5B89\u88C5{2}\u6216\u66F4\u9AD8\u7248\u672C\u5E76\u542F\u7528\u540E\u53EF\u4EE5\u4FEE\u590D\u3002
PluginWrapper.disabled={0}\u5DF2\u88AB\u7981\u7528\u3002\u542F\u7528\u540E\u53EF\u4EE5\u4FEE\u590D\u3002
PluginWrapper.obsolete={0}\u9700\u8981\u6BD4{1}\u66F4\u9AD8\u7684\u7248\u672C\u3002\u5B89\u88C5{2}\u6216\u66F4\u9AD8\u7684\u7248\u672C\u53EF\u4EE5\u4FEE\u590D\u3002
PluginWrapper.obsoleteCore=\u4F60\u5FC5\u987B\u628A Jenkins \u4ECE{0}\u66F4\u65B0\u5230{1}\u6216\u66F4\u9AD8\u7684\u7248\u672C\u6765\u8FD0\u884C\u8BE5\u63D2\u4EF6\u3002
PluginWrapper.obsoleteJava=\u4F60\u5FC5\u987B\u628A Java \u4ECE{0}\u66F4\u65B0\u5230{1}\u6216\u66F4\u9AD8\u7684\u7248\u672C\u6765\u8FD0\u884C\u8BE5\u63D2\u4EF6\u3002
PluginWrapper.PluginWrapperAdministrativeMonitor.DisplayName=\u63D2\u4EF6\u52A0\u8F7D\u5931\u8D25
PluginWrapper.Already.Disabled=\u63D2\u4EF6''{0}''\u5DF2\u7ECF\u88AB\u7981\u7528
PluginWrapper.Plugin.Has.Dependent=\u63D2\u4EF6''{0}''\u5DF2\u7ECF\u5B58\u5728\uFF0C\u81F3\u5C11\u6709\u4E00\u4E2A\u4F9D\u8D56\u63D2\u4EF6({1})\uFF0C\u7981\u7528\u7B56\u7565\u4E3A{2}\uFF0C\u56E0\u6B64\uFF0C\u5B83\u4E0D\u53EF\u4EE5\u88AB\u7981\u7528
PluginWrapper.Plugin.Disabled=\u63D2\u4EF6''{0}''\u5DF2\u7ECF\u88AB\u7981\u7528
PluginWrapper.NoSuchPlugin=\u627E\u4E0D\u5230''{0}''\u8FD9\u6837\u7684\u63D2\u4EF6
PluginWrapper.Error.Disabling=\u7981\u7528\u63D2\u4EF6''{0}''\u65F6\u53D1\u751F\u9519\u8BEF\u3002\u9519\u8BEF\u662F\uFF1A''{1}''
TcpSlaveAgentListener.PingAgentProtocol.displayName=Ping \u534F\u8BAE
Original file line number Diff line number Diff line change
Expand Up @@ -24,5 +24,5 @@ Correct=\u7EA0\u6B63
Dependency\ errors=\u4F9D\u8D56\u9519\u8BEF
Downstream\ dependency\ errors=\u4E0B\u6E38\u4F9D\u8D56\u9519\u8BEF

blurbOriginal=\u90E8\u5206\u63D2\u4EF6\u7531\u4E8E\u7F3A\u5C11\u4EE5\u6765\u65E0\u6CD5\u52A0\u8F7D\u3002\u8981\u6062\u590D\u8FD9\u4E9B\u63D2\u4EF6\u63D0\u4F9B\u7684\u529F\u80FD\uFF0C\u9700\u8981\u4FEE\u590D\u8FD9\u4E9B\u95EE\u9898\u5E76\u91CD\u542F Jenkins\u3002
blurbOriginal=\u90E8\u5206\u63D2\u4EF6\u7531\u4E8E\u7F3A\u5C11\u4F9D\u8D56\u65E0\u6CD5\u52A0\u8F7D\u3002\u8981\u6062\u590D\u8FD9\u4E9B\u63D2\u4EF6\u63D0\u4F9B\u7684\u529F\u80FD\uFF0C\u9700\u8981\u4FEE\u590D\u8FD9\u4E9B\u95EE\u9898\u5E76\u91CD\u542F Jenkins\u3002
blurbDerived=\u7531\u4E8E\u4E00\u4E2A\u6216\u8005\u591A\u4E2A\u4E0A\u9762\u7684\u9519\u8BEF\u5BFC\u81F4\u8FD9\u4E9B\u63D2\u4EF6\u65E0\u6CD5\u52A0\u8F7D\u3002\u4FEE\u590D\u540E\u63D2\u4EF6\u5C06\u4F1A\u518D\u6B21\u52A0\u8F7D\u3002

0 comments on commit ac86546

Please sign in to comment.